Output 352934911b9b8d2e88a7d4f28a71fd74d1207534f1ee89e9f76da7c58fda61a7:16

value
521081
script pubkey
OP_0 OP_PUSHBYTES_20 f69244310f85d3f700f320980b91696f223a4f4d
address
bc1q76fygvg0shflwq8nyzvqhytfdu3r5n6dpfn7v0
transaction
352934911b9b8d2e88a7d4f28a71fd74d1207534f1ee89e9f76da7c58fda61a7
confirmations
223739
spent
true